linux命令的常用方法

fiy 其他 10

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    Linux操作系统提供了丰富的命令行工具,通过这些命令可以完成各种操作。下面列举一些常用的Linux命令及其使用方法:

    1. ls:列出目录内容
    – ls:列出当前目录的文件和子目录
    – ls -l:以长格式显示目录内容,包括文件权限、所有者、大小等信息
    – ls -a:显示所有文件,包括隐藏文件
    – ls -h:以人类可读的方式显示文件大小

    2. cd:切换目录
    – cd 目录名:进入指定的目录
    – cd ~:进入当前用户的主目录
    – cd ..:返回上级目录
    – cd -:返回切换前的目录

    3. pwd:显示当前所在目录的路径

    4. mkdir:创建目录
    – mkdir 目录名:创建一个新的目录
    – mkdir -p 目录路径:递归创建多级目录

    5. rm:删除文件或目录
    – rm 文件名:删除指定的文件
    – rm -r 目录名:递归删除目录及其下所有文件

    6. cp:复制文件或目录
    – cp 源文件 目标文件:将源文件复制到目标文件
    – cp -r 源目录 目标目录:递归复制目录及其下所有文件

    7. mv:移动文件或目录,也可以用于重命名文件和目录
    – mv 源文件 目标文件:将源文件移动到目标文件
    – mv 源目录 目标目录:将源目录移动到目标目录
    – mv 文件名 新文件名:将文件重命名为新文件名

    8. touch:创建空文件或修改文件的时间戳
    – touch 文件名:创建一个新的空文件
    – touch -a 文件名:只修改文件的访问时间
    – touch -m 文件名:只修改文件的修改时间

    9. cat:显示文件内容
    – cat 文件名:将文件内容输出到终端
    – cat 文件1 文件2 > 新文件:将文件1和文件2的内容合并到新文件中

    10. grep:在文件中搜索指定的内容
    – grep 搜索内容 文件名:在文件中搜索指定的内容,并输出匹配的行
    – grep -v 搜索内容 文件名:输出不包含指定内容的行

    11. ps:显示进程信息
    – ps:显示当前用户运行的进程
    – ps -ef:显示所有用户运行的进程
    – ps -aux:显示详细的进程信息,包括用户、CPU使用率等

    12. top:实时显示系统的资源占用情况
    – top:显示系统资源使用情况,按照CPU使用率进行排序
    – top -u 用户名:只显示指定用户的进程信息

    13. chmod:修改文件或目录的权限
    – chmod 权限 文件名:修改文件或目录的权限
    – 权限分为三部分:所有者权限、群组权限、其他用户权限,每个部分又可以分为读、写、执行三个权限

    这些只是Linux命令中的一小部分,Linux操作系统有很多其他命令,可以根据自己的需求来学习和使用。通过不断的实践和探索,相信你会掌握更多的Linux命令并运用于实际操作中。

    2年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    Linux命令是Linux操作系统中的核心工具之一,它们用于执行各种任务,从文件和目录管理到进程控制和系统配置。以下是一些常用的Linux命令及其用法:

    1. ls:用于列出当前目录中的文件和子目录。可以使用不同的选项来改变列出的格式,比如“ls -l”会显示更详细的信息,包括文件权限和所有者。

    2. cd:用于更改当前工作目录。可以使用绝对路径或相对路径来指定新目录的位置,比如“cd /usr/share”将切换到/usr/share目录。

    3. cp:用于复制文件或目录。可以使用“cp source destination”命令将源文件或目录复制到目标位置。还可以使用不同的选项来设置复制的行为,比如“-r”选项以递归的方式复制目录。

    4. mv:用于移动或重命名文件和目录。可以使用“mv source destination”命令将源文件或目录移动到目标位置,或者使用“mv oldname newname”命令将文件或目录重命名。

    5. rm:用于删除文件和目录。可以使用“rm filename”命令删除指定的文件,或使用“rm -r directoryname”命令删除指定的目录及其内容。请注意,在使用此命令时要十分小心,因为删除操作是不可恢复的。

    6. cat:用于显示文件内容。可以使用“cat filename”命令在终端中显示文件的全部内容,或者使用“cat file1 file2”命令将多个文件的内容连接并显示在一起。

    7. grep:用于在文件中查找指定模式的行。可以使用“grep pattern filename”命令在指定文件中搜索包含指定模式的行。还可以使用不同的选项来设置搜索的行为。

    8. chmod:用于修改文件或目录的权限。可以使用“chmod mode filename”命令为文件或目录设置新的权限。权限可以使用数字表示(如777)或符号表示(如u+rwx)。

    9. sudo:用于以超级用户权限运行命令。可以使用“sudo command”命令以root用户的身份执行指定的命令。在执行需要管理员权限的操作时,经常需要使用sudo命令。

    10. man:用于查看命令的帮助手册。可以使用“man command”命令查看指定命令的详细说明,包括用法和选项。man命令非常有用,特别是当你对某个命令不熟悉或需要了解更多信息时。

    以上是一些Linux命令的常用方法,当然还有很多其他的命令和用法可以用于不同的用途。通过学习和实践,逐渐掌握这些命令将使您更加熟练地使用Linux操作系统。

    2年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    Linux操作系统拥有丰富而强大的命令行工具,掌握这些命令对于Linux系统的管理和使用非常重要。下面是一些常用的Linux命令方法的介绍:

    一、基本命令

    1. cd命令:切换目录,用法为 cd [目录路径]。

    2. ls命令:列出当前目录的文件和子目录,用法为 ls [选项] [路径]。

    3. mkdir命令:创建新的目录,用法为 mkdir [选项] 目录名。

    4. rmdir命令:删除空目录,用法为 rmdir [选项] 目录名。

    5. rm命令:删除文件或目录,用法为 rm [选项] 文件名或目录名。

    6. pwd命令:显示当前工作目录,用法为 pwd。

    7. cat命令:连接文件并打印到标准输出,用法为 cat [选项] [文件名]。

    8. cp命令:复制文件或目录,用法为 cp [选项] 源文件 目标文件。

    9. mv命令:移动或重命名文件或目录,用法为 mv [选项] 源文件 目标文件。

    10. touch命令:创建空文件或改变文件的时间属性,用法为 touch [选项] 文件名。

    11. clear命令:清屏,用法为 clear。

    12. echo命令:打印字符串,用法为 echo [选项] [字符串]。

    13. history命令:显示历史命令,用法为 history [选项]。

    14. exit命令:退出当前终端会话,用法为 exit。

    二、文件和目录管理

    1. find命令:在指定目录下查找文件,用法为 find [路径] [选项]。

    2. grep命令:在文件中查找指定的字符串,用法为 grep [选项] 字符串 文件名。

    3. head命令:显示文件的前几行,默认为前10行,用法为 head [选项] 文件名。

    4. tail命令:显示文件的后几行,默认为后10行,用法为 tail [选项] 文件名。

    5. wc命令:统计文件的行数、单词数和字符数,用法为 wc [选项] 文件名。

    6. chmod命令:改变文件或目录的权限,用法为 chmod [选项] 权限 文件名或目录名。

    7. chown命令:改变文件或目录的所有者,用法为 chown [选项] 用户名 文件名或目录名。

    8. chgrp命令:改变文件或目录的所属组,用法为 chgrp [选项] 组名 文件名或目录名。

    9. ln命令:创建链接文件,用法为 ln [选项] [源文件] [目标文件]。

    10. tar命令:打包和解压文件,用法为 tar [选项] [文件名]。

    三、系统管理

    1. ps命令:查看系统中正在运行的进程,用法为 ps [选项]。

    2. top命令:实时显示系统的进程状态,用法为 top。

    3. du命令:显示文件或目录的磁盘使用情况,用法为 du [选项] [文件名或目录名]。

    4. df命令:显示文件系统的磁盘空间使用情况,用法为 df [选项]。

    5. free命令:显示系统的内存使用情况,用法为 free [选项]。

    6. uname命令:显示当前系统的信息,用法为 uname [选项]。

    7. shutdown命令:关闭或重启系统,用法为 shutdown [选项] 时间。

    8. ifconfig命令:配置和显示网络接口的信息,用法为 ifconfig [选项] [接口名]。

    9. ping命令:测试网络连接的连通性,用法为 ping [选项] 目标主机。

    10. netstat命令:显示网络连接、路由表和接口统计信息,用法为 netstat [选项]。

    以上只是常用的一部分Linux命令,还有很多其他命令可以使用。对于每个命令可以使用 “man 命令名” 查看详细的帮助信息。通过不断的学习和实践,掌握更多的Linux命令和技巧,可以更高效地进行系统管理和任务处理。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部